High DeKalb Water Bill Checklist Before You Dispute

A high DeKalb water bill should be handled in two tracks: first, check whether usage actually increased; second, protect your dispute rights before the due date. Do not wait until after the bill is due if you believe the bill is wrong.

Smart meter data Check portal usage before calling. A sudden spike may point to a leak or meter issue.
Running toilet A silent toilet leak can create a major water/sewer bill. Try a dye test.
Outdoor leak Check irrigation, outdoor spigots, wet yard areas, pool fill lines and service line signs.
Sewer charges Water and sewer charges may both rise when water usage increases.
Payment mismatch Review payment history before making a duplicate payment on the wrong account.
Dispute timing File the dispute before the due date to reduce late-fee or disconnection risk.

Gather these before contacting DeKalb

  • Current bill and previous bill.
  • Billing account number and service address.
  • Smart meter consumption data or usage screenshot.
  • Payment confirmation if you recently paid.
  • Leak repair invoice, plumber receipt, parts receipt or photos if a leak was fixed.
  • Phone number where DeKalb can reach you.

How to Dispute a DeKalb Water Bill

DeKalb County has a formal water billing dispute process. This is not the same as simply calling and saying your bill looks high. The county says to file the dispute before the bill due date, and you must still pay the undisputed portion by the due date.

Important rule: While the disputed amount is under review, DeKalb says you do not have to pay the disputed amount, but you still need to pay the part of the bill that is not in dispute by the due date.
  1. Open the official dispute option.
    Use the county’s Water Billing Dispute Request Form.
  2. File before the due date.
    Do not wait until after late fees or service action becomes a problem.
  3. Include required account details.
    DeKalb asks customers to include service address, billing account number and a phone number where they can be reached.
  4. Pay the undisputed amount.
    If only part of the bill is disputed, pay the part you agree is owed by the due date.
  5. Watch for county response.
    DeKalb says it will confirm receipt of the dispute within 10 business days.
  6. Resolve the adjusted balance.
    After the review, DeKalb says customers must pay the adjusted balance within 10 days or call Customer Service at 404-378-4475 to set up a payment plan.
Other dispute contact option: DeKalb also lists Customer Assurance email at customerassurance@dekalbcountyga.gov for water bill disputes.

DeKalb Water Main Break, Sewer Backup, No Water or Water Quality Emergency

Water emergencies should not be handled through a normal payment page. DeKalb County lists a 24-hour emergency line for water main breaks, sewer backups, no water service and water quality issues.

24-hour emergency line: Call 770-270-6243 for urgent DeKalb water and sewer emergencies.
  1. Call the emergency line first.
    Use this for water main breaks, sewer backups, no water service and water quality concerns.
  2. Give the exact location.
    Provide the nearest address, cross street, landmark, subdivision or visible utility marker.
  3. Stay away from unsafe water or sewage.
    Keep children, pets and vehicles away from contaminated water, open manholes, sinkholes or street flooding.
  4. Take photos only if safe.
    Photos may help your own records, but safety comes first.
  5. Follow up later for billing questions.
    If the emergency affects your bill, handle the safety issue first, then contact billing or Customer Assurance.

DeKalb Water and Sewer Rates: What to Check Before Complaining About the Bill

DeKalb County publishes current water and sewer rates and an average usage calculator. A bill can rise because of usage, sewer charges, readiness-to-serve fees, leaks, household size, irrigation or higher usage tiers.

Water usage tiers Higher usage can move more gallons into higher-rate tiers.
Sewer charges Sewer charges can be a major part of the bill unless your property has a septic tank.
Readiness-to-serve fees Fixed service-related fees may appear even when usage is low.
Household size More people generally means higher water and sewer consumption.
Irrigation or outdoor use Outdoor watering can push usage into higher tiers quickly.
Leak repair credit If you fixed a leak, ask customer service what proof is needed for any possible credit or adjustment.

High Water Bill & Leak Troubleshooter

A high bill can be caused by leaks, irrigation, estimated readings, seasonal use, or account/meter issues. Choose the closest problem below.

Quick leak test Turn off all water, then check whether the meter still moves.
Toilet check Put food coloring in tank. If color reaches bowl without flushing, there may be a leak.
Ask utility Request usage history, meter reread, leak adjustment policy, and payment arrangement options.
